Overlake's Writer's Symposium coming in March

writer's symposium

An annual literary tradition continues at Overlake as the Writer's Symposium comes to campus in March. This year, students in the Upper School will hear from author and artist M.K. Asante. Seniors will do advance preparation for his visit by reading Asante's Buck. Asante visits March 6 and will hold an evening session for families from 6:15-7:15pm in the Library. 

Meanwhile, in the Middle School, students will get a visit from local young adult author Justina Chen this year. Chen is the author of Nothing But the Truth and a Few White Lies, which will be featured in 7th and 8th grade English classes.
